There’s ongoing drama in the Denver Broncos camp. Each new day brings us something new. As the decision to bench the star QB Russell Wilson was made public, uproars started. Even at the press conference, HC Sean Payton was hounded with questions about the QB. And now Wilson has taken a different route.

It was the blockbuster trade of 2022, as Wilson was transferred from the Seattle Seahawks to the Broncos. Many hoped he would be the second coming of Peyton Manning, but fate did not have that in store for Wilson. Amidst the reports that he would be cut from the Broncos roster, Wilson posted his glorious highlights in the Broncos’ jersey.

Earlier, HC Payton defended his move of benching Wilson in favor of Jarrett Stidham. “We’re desperately trying to win”, said Payton, referring to their uphill battle for the playoffs. But Wilson shared a life lesson about the incompatibility of anxiety and gratitude on his social media. “Gratitude… Gratitude, anxiety, and worry can’t exist at the same time. Not simultaneously.“, he wrote.

Wilson posted a highlight reel from the Week 16 game against the New England Patriots. A game in which the Broncos lost 23-26. But the video shows that the fault does not lie with Wilson. And his stats show the same picture.

The Super Bowl winner has thrown at least 1 TD pass in all the games till now. A distinction very few QBs can claim this season. The 35-year-old has registered 26 TDs, the same as Patrick Mahomes. And his guidance and leadership cannot be doubted. So in his forced absence, can the Broncos even get to the playoffs?

When asked the reasoning to bench Wilson, HC Payton said, “To get a spark offensively”. And there is no doubt that the Broncos need a spark to make it through the playoffs. Currently, they have only a 7% chance, a win would take them to 12%. But that still won’t be enough.

The Broncos desperately need favorable results elsewhere as they lock horns with divisional rivals, the Los Angeles Chargers. However, there is a prevailing thought that the Broncos have already given up on the season, with many suggesting that the decision to bench Wilson has more to do with economics than to win.
